Josh celebrates 2nd anniversary with new campaign for creators
New Delhi, Sep 1
India's fastest growing and most engaged short-video app, Josh on Thursday announced that it is celebrating its second anniversary by unveiling its latest digital campaign and recognising the contribution of the diverse creator community on the app.
The company said that the new campaign brings out the passion of Josh creators and serves as an ode to the unique talents of the community.
"Josh belongs to its creators -- they literally make us the success we are. While this campaign announces two years of Josh, it's actually a tribute to every creator. It is their birthday as much as it is ours," Samir Vora, Chief Marketing Officer, VerSe Innovation, said in a statement.
"Creators have strived to bring quality content to their audiences and we celebrate the diversity of our creator ecosystem. We look forward to another year of redefining the space of content creation and bringing bigger and better experiences to our audience," Vora added.The campaign film brings together diverse creators -- from a beauty influencer to a fitness enthusiast -- who have entertained and engaged the country with their content.
The campaign conceptualised and executed by What's Your Problem -- A Wondrlab company, pays tribute to all the creators who make the app what it is.
"We wanted the film to look as stylish and cool as the content these creators make. At the same time, it was important that the film looked real, hence we shot with real creators at real locations. Yash Danak, the director, brought an amazing energy to the film, with interesting camera movements, sharp editing and buzzy music," said Amit Akali, co-founder and CCO, Wondrlab.
Over the last two years, Josh has strengthened its creator community and currently boasts of 1000+ best creators on the platform. Josh believes in creating opportunities and building avenues for a young India to create content that celebrates and inspires the youth.
As part of the anniversary celebration, Josh has also launched #DOUBLEDHAMAKA challenge, which runs till September 3, inviting users to create videos by teaming up into pairs.
